1. Comprehending Safety Standards: The Non-Negotiable Factor
Security is the single most important factor to consider when purchasing a nursery cot. In many nations, cots need to pass rigid safety regulations before they can be offered. When shopping, parents need to guarantee the cot complies with existing nationwide and worldwide security standards.
Secret Safety Checklist:
- Slat Spacing: The distance in between the cot slats should be no more than 6 centimeters (about 2.3 inches) to avoid a baby's head from getting stuck.
- Matte and Finish: Ensure the paint or surface is non-toxic and baby-safe, as teething babies enjoy to chew on the top rails.
- Drop-Sides: Modern safety requirements greatly limit or ban drop-side cots due to mechanical failures. Fixed-side cots are widely suggested.
- Bed mattress Fit: There should be no more than a 2-3 cm space between the mattress edges and the cot frame to prevent entrapment risks.

3. Necessary Features to Look For
Beyond fundamental safety and design, numerous practical features can make everyday parenting regimens much smoother.
- Adjustable Mattress Base: Newborns can not roll or sit, so the mattress should be positioned at its highest position to save moms and dads' backs. As the baby begins to sit and stand, the base needs to be reduced to avoid climbing out.
- Teething Rails: Plastic or silicone strips connected to the top edges of the cot secure the wooden frame from teething marks and safeguard the baby's gums.
- Integrated Storage: Some cots include integrated drawers beneath, which is a huge bonus for nurseries lacking floor area.
- Movement: Lockable wheels can be useful for moving the cot around for cleaning or repositioning, though stationary legs are equally stable.

5. Choosing the Right Mattress
A cot is just as great as its bed mattress. Moms and dads often make the error of investing a fortune on the cot beds for sale frame while cutting corners on the bed mattress. A firm, breathable, and supportive bed mattress is important for infant security and back advancement.
Kinds Of Cot Mattresses:
- Foam Mattresses: Lightweight and affordable cots, however guarantee the foam is high-density and keeps its shape.
- Pocket Sprung Mattresses: Offer exceptional support as the kid grows and distributes weight equally.
- Natural Mattresses: Made from coconut coir, wool, and latex; highly breathable and eco-friendly.
Suggestion: Always purchase a brand name brand-new bed mattress for a new baby. Second-hand mattresses can harbor dust mites, bacteria, and lose their firmness, increasing the threat of Sudden Infant Death Syndrome (SIDS).
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: When should I decrease the cot mattress base?
A: You ought to reduce the bed mattress base as quickly as your baby starts pressing up on their hands and knees, or when they can sit unaided. This usually happens around 5 to 6 months of age.
Q2: What is the distinction between a cot and a cot bed?
A: A basic cot is smaller sized and normally used up until the kid is about 2 years old. A cot bed is bigger and designed to transform into a young child bed by removing the side panels, permitting it to be utilized until the child is roughly 4 or 5 years of ages.
Q3: Are drop-side cots safe?
A: Traditional drop-side cots have actually been banned or heavily limited in lots of regions due to historical security risks involving mechanical failures that developed unsafe spaces. Modern fixed-side cots with adjustable bed mattress heights are much more secure and extensively recommended.
Q4: Can I use pre-owned cot furnishings?
A: Yes, you can utilize a second-hand cot frame, provided it fulfills present safety requirements, has all its original hardware, does not have actually missing out on or broken slats, and the paint is non-toxic and not breaking. Nevertheless, you ought to constantly purchase a new mattress.
Q5: Do I require bumpers or pillows in the cot?
A: No. For safe sleep standards, the cot must remain completely bare of pillows, bumpers, heavy blankets, and packed animals till the kid is at least 12 months old to minimize the threat of suffocation.
